Your mouth operates as a complex chemical environment where pH levels directly influence your dental health. When your oral pH drops below 5.5, tooth enamel begins to weaken through a process called demineralization, creating the perfect conditions for cavity formation. Understanding this delicate balance empowers you to take proactive steps toward maintaining stronger, healthier teeth throughout your life.

Understanding Your Mouth’s Natural pH System
Your saliva naturally maintains a pH between 6.2 and 7.6, creating a protective environment for your teeth. This slightly alkaline state helps neutralize harmful acids produced by bacteria in your mouth. When you consume acidic foods or drinks, your oral pH temporarily drops, triggering a natural defense mechanism where saliva works to restore balance.
The process involves multiple factors working together. Saliva production increases during meals, delivering essential minerals like calcium and phosphate to your teeth. These minerals help remineralize enamel that has been softened by acid exposure. However, when acid attacks occur frequently or saliva production decreases, your mouth’s natural defense system becomes overwhelmed.
Your teeth’s enamel contains hydroxyapatite crystals that dissolve when exposed to acids with a pH below the critical threshold. This dissolution doesn’t immediately create cavities but weakens the tooth structure over time. Understanding this process helps explain why the timing and frequency of acidic exposure matter more than occasional consumption.
Factors That Disrupt Your Oral pH Balance
Diet plays the primary role in determining your mouth’s pH throughout the day. Citrus fruits, sodas, wine, and coffee create acidic conditions that persist for 20 to 60 minutes after consumption. Sports drinks and energy beverages often surprise patients with their high acidity levels, sometimes rivaling the pH of battery acid.
Beyond dietary choices, several other factors influence your oral environment. Dry mouth conditions significantly reduce saliva’s protective effects, whether caused by medications, medical treatments, or natural aging processes. Bacterial overgrowth from poor oral hygiene creates additional acid production, compounding dietary effects.
Stress and sleep patterns also affect saliva production and composition. During sleep, saliva flow naturally decreases, which explains why morning breath occurs and why bedtime oral hygiene routines prove so critical. Certain medications, including antihistamines and antidepressants, can further reduce saliva production, creating additional challenges for maintaining optimal pH balance.
Frequent snacking creates repeated acid attacks throughout the day. Each time you eat, bacteria in your mouth metabolize sugars and starches, producing lactic acid as a byproduct. The frequency of these attacks matters more than the total amount of sugar consumed, making meal timing an important consideration for oral health.
Protecting and Restoring Optimal pH Balance
Simple dietary modifications can significantly improve your oral pH stability. Consuming acidic foods and drinks during meals rather than as standalone snacks reduces their impact. Following acidic consumption with water helps dilute acids and stimulate saliva production. Waiting at least 60 minutes after consuming acidic substances before brushing allows your enamel to reharden naturally.
Incorporating pH-neutralizing foods into your diet provides additional protection. Cheese, nuts, and leafy greens help raise oral pH levels while providing beneficial minerals. Sugar-free gum stimulates saliva production, particularly varieties containing xylitol, which may actively reduce harmful bacterial levels.
Professional fluoride treatments strengthen enamel’s resistance to acid attacks by converting hydroxyapatite to fluorapatite, a more acid-resistant compound. The timing of oral hygiene routines affects pH balance significantly. Brushing before breakfast protects teeth during morning acid exposure, while evening routines remove bacterial buildup before the vulnerable overnight period. Using toothpaste with appropriate fluoride levels supports your mouth’s natural remineralization processes.

Some patients benefit from at-home pH monitoring using indicator strips that reveal real-time oral acidity levels. This information helps identify problematic dietary patterns and validates the effectiveness of preventive strategies. Understanding your individual pH patterns enables more targeted protective measures.
